2.3.2 Bypass Mode
After power-on, the UPS works in bypass mode if the inverter does not start or has
been manually shut down. In normal mode, the UPS transfers to bypass mode
when it detects power unit overtemperature, overload, or other faults that may
cause the inverter to shut down. The power supply in bypass mode is not
protected by the UPS and therefore tends to be aected by the mains outage and
abnormal AC voltage waveform or frequency.
